CHENNAI, FEB. 20. Elections to the All-India Sai Samaj at Mylapore, scheduled for February 20, have been postponed as the Madras High Court has reserved its orders today on a civil suit. Some members of the Samaj who had been disqualified from contesting in the elections filed the suit, seeking a direction to permit them to remain in the fray. The senior advocate and former Additional Advocate-General, T.R. Rajagopalan, is the court-appointed Advocate Commissioner for the elections.
